Your audio guide to this weekend’s Canadian Folk Music Awards

Folk/roots fans in Vancouver are in for a marathon of great music this week as the Canadian Folk Music Awards get under way.

The festivities kick off tomorrow night with the Rogue Folk Club’s B.C. artists showcase and continue through the weekend with a traditional music concert on Friday night and a songwriters concert, film screening, family music concert and the two awards presentation concerts on the weekend.

Tickets are still available on Eventbrite.  But if you’re having a hard time deciding what to see, we’ve put together this handy audio guide for you in the form of short Spotify playlists featuring the artists performing at each of the shows.
